The AES Corporation announced a reorganization as part of its ongoing strategy to simplify its portfolio, optimize its cost structure and reduce its carbon intensity. Reflecting AES' simplified portfolio, the company is consolidating its five Strategic Business Unit structure and will now manage its global operations and infrastructure activities under Executive Vice President and Chief Operating Officer, Bernerd Da Santos. The company also has reorganized its growth and commercial activities into three new units.

These units will be led by three existing executives and they are, Executive Vice President and Chief Financial Officer, Tom O'Flynn will continue in his current role and assume additional responsibility for leading the US Renewables growth unit; Manuel Pérez Dubuc will lead a consolidated South America growth unit that includes Argentina, Brazil, Chile and Colombia; and Juan Ignacio Rubiolo will lead the Mexico, Central America and the Caribbean growth unit. The new leaner organizational structure reflects the simplification of the company's portfolio and cumulative investments in IT, and will result in a lower headcount and overhead costs. This initiative supports the company's objectives of achieving investment grade metrics by 2019 and delivering attractive returns.

The new organizational structure will also accelerate the application of new technologies in AES' existing businesses.
